Stuffed Potatoes
Neatly wipe eight even-sized, large raw potatoes; place them in a roasting tin and bake in the oven for forty-five minutes; remove, cut in two lengthwise, then with a teaspoon scoop out the interiors into a bowl and keep six shells apart. Season the potatoes with a half teaspoon salt, two saltspoons pepper and a saltspoon grated nutmeg, add half ounce butter and half gill cream. Mix well with a wooden spoon, then fill up the six half shells with the puree, neatly smooth the surface with the blade of a knife, sprinkle a tablespoon of grated Parmesan cheese evenly divided over them, place on a roasting tin and arrange a very little bit of butter over each potato. Set in the oven for ten minutes dress on a dish with a folded napkin and serve.
